We are now looking for a DevOps Engineer to join our Power & Controls division at Tranby. The offices are centrally located 10 minutes from Drammen and 30 minutes from Oslo. In this role, you will work with the operation, maintenance, and continuous improvement of Power & Controls' internal development and R&D infrastructure. You will support project teams by ensuring stable and secure platforms, reliable tooling, and efficient development environments across ongoing and upcoming projects.
Job Responsibility
Operate, maintain, and continuously improve a self-hosted, Linux-based infrastructure, primarily built on Debian and VMware clusters
Manage and maintain lab network infrastructure
develop and implement network security strategies with corporate IT
Manage and evolve core development and R&D services such as Git, Github, Jenkins, Redmine, simulators, and code review tools
Maintain and optimize network services, including Apache, NFS, SSH, monitoring, and remote access solutions
Ensure stable, secure, and well-maintained database platforms (PostgreSQL and MySQL)
Manage and support backup and recovery solutions, including Bacula and Veeam
Manage software licenses and related agreements
Support project teams with tooling, CI/CD workflows, and development environments
Introduce new services, automation, and improved ways of working to support upcoming projects
Define and drive a holistic infrastructure strategy across disciplines
Troubleshoot and resolve issues across infrastructure, services, and development workflows
Act as the main technical interface towards corporate IT, ensuring alignment with cybersecurity requirements and infrastructure compliance
Requirements
Solid experience with Linux system administration (preferably Debian/Ubuntu or similar)
Hands-on experience with virtualization (VMware or equivalent) and infrastructure operations
Good understanding of networking principles and common Linux network services (e.g. Apache, NFS, SSH)
Scripting skills (Bash, Python, or similar) used for automation and tooling
Experience working with development infrastructure, such as Git and CI/CD systems (e.g. Jenkins or similar tools)
Experience with network administration
A structured and reliable way of working, with strong focus on stability, quality, and maintainability
A proactive, solution-oriented mindset, with motivation to support project teams
Strong collaboration skills and the ability to work effectively across disciplines and stakeholders
Ability to obtain and maintain security clearance, in line with project and customer requirements
